Gayeshwar: Jamaat-e-Islami Has No Chance of Coming to Power in Bangladesh

BNP Standing Committee member Gayeshwar Chandra Roy has said that Jamaat-e-Islami will never be able to form a government in Bangladesh.

He remarked, “I am sure that Jamaat-e-Islami has no chance of coming to power in Bangladesh until the end of time.”

He made these comments during a discussion event held at the residence of Mir Sarfat Ali Sapu, Volunteer Affairs Secretary of the BNP Central Executive Committee, in Srinagar, Munshiganj, on Sunday afternoon.Criticizing Jamaat’s political strategy, Gayeshwar stated that Jamaat’s presence in India and Pakistan serves as clear proof of their failure to connect with the people. He further alleged that Jamaat refuses to understand the public’s voice, focusing solely on advancing their own interests.

According to him, the demands raised by Jamaat-e-Islami are designed only to disrupt the electoral process. He claimed that Jamaat cannot accept the possibility of BNP returning to power without the involvement of the Awami League, implying that Jamaat’s political tactics are aimed at creating obstacles in BNP’s path to forming a government.

BNP Central Executive Committee Joint Secretary General Advocate Abdus Salam Azad, Volunteer Affairs Secretary Mir Sarfat Ali Sapu, and several other leaders and activists were also present at the event.
